Finance Review Summary — Q3 Cash-Flow Forecast, Ostrane Ltd

The quarterly forecast shows inflows tracking 4% above plan, driven by earlier renewals on the Fenwick accounts. Outflows rise modestly from the Tarbell tooling upgrade. Net position stays positive through the quarter, with a thinner margin in month two. Sales leads should hold discounting discipline during that window. The confidential planning note follows below.

internal memo for kaguf-yajog: Headcount on the Druath team goes from 30 to 70 by the end of November. Gross margin on Druath came in at 56 percent against a plan of 28 percent.

# Heads up, new folks: the SheetForge export client below is memory-hungry.
# Exporting a large workbook pulls every row into RAM before streaming, so
# anything over ~200k rows will happily eat a few gigs. We cap batch size at
# 5k rows as a workaround until the streaming rewrite lands (ask Tomas Brell
# about the Quillbatch project). The client authenticates against the internal
# Orlow export gateway on startup. For local runs, initialize it with the key
# that follows.

service key, tahaf-yaduf: qvz11-icGvt2med8u

Ticket: Staging env misconfigured for Siftgate bloom filter

The bloom layer in front of the Pellet KV store is rejecting all lookups in staging because the env file was copied from the dev template without credentials. False-positive tuning values are fine; only the auth line is missing. To unblock the weekly demo, the Pellet admission secret must be set on the following line.

env line for yaguf-fajop: LEDGER_TOKEN13=fb08984397349

- [ ] Verify the TumbleVault locker access flow end-to-end: badge scan, PIN fallback, and door-release timeout. Confirm the Stainwick depot config matches staging. If the PIN fallback stalls, roll back before the kiosks sync at midnight. Maintainers: the access daemon logs to the usual place; check door-release latency there first. The staging build that passed all gate checks is identified below.

session token of tajef-bageg = htk21_5d90d574934f3ccae6437